NodeImplBase.Scoped| Constructor and Description |
|---|
ImportDirective(Ide packageIde,
String typeName) |
ImportDirective(JooSymbol importKeyword,
Ide ide,
JooSymbol symSemicolon) |
| Modifier and Type | Method and Description |
|---|---|
void |
analyze(AstNode parentNode) |
boolean |
equals(Object o) |
List<? extends AstNode> |
getChildren() |
Ide |
getIde() |
JooSymbol |
getImportKeyword() |
String |
getQualifiedName() |
JooSymbol |
getSymbol() |
JooSymbol |
getSymSemicolon()
null if not explicit
|
int |
hashCode() |
boolean |
isExplicit() |
void |
scope(Scope scope) |
String |
toString() |
void |
visit(AstVisitor visitor) |
isClassMember, isStatic, setClassMemberanalyze, getParentNode, makeChildren, scope, withNewDeclarationScope, withNewLabelScopepublic List<? extends AstNode> getChildren()
getChildren in interface AstNodegetChildren in class NodeImplBasepublic void visit(AstVisitor visitor) throws IOException
IOExceptionpublic void scope(Scope scope)
public void analyze(AstNode parentNode)
analyze in interface AstNodeanalyze in class NodeImplBasepublic String getQualifiedName()
public JooSymbol getSymbol()
public JooSymbol getImportKeyword()
public Ide getIde()
public JooSymbol getSymSemicolon()
public boolean isExplicit()
Copyright © 2002–2016 CoreMedia AG. All rights reserved.